CORPORATIONS (ABORIGINAL AND TORRES STRAIT ISLANDER) ACT 2006 - SECT 220.10 Members' access to minutes

CORPORATIONS (ABORIGINAL AND TORRES STRAIT ISLANDER) ACT 2006 - SECT 220.10

Members' access to minutes

  (1)   An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ander corporation that is registered as a large corporation must make available for inspection by members, at its registered office, the minute books for the meetings of its members and for resolutions of members passed without meetings. The books must be made available for inspection each business day from at least 10 am to 12 noon and from at least 2 pm to 4 pm.

Note:   Failing to comply with this subsection is an offence under section   376 - 1.

  (2)   An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ander corporation that is registered as a small or medium corporation must make available for inspection by members, at its document access address, the minute books for the meetings of its members and for resolutions of members passed without meetings. The books must be made available within 7 days of a member's written request for inspection.

Note:   Failing to comply with this subsection is an offence under section   376 - 1.

  (3)   A corporation must make minutes available under subsections   (1) and (2) free of charge.

Penalty:   5 penalty units.

  (4)   A member of an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ander corporation may ask the corporation in writing for a copy of:

  (a)   any minutes of a meeting of the corporation's members or an extract of the minutes; or

  (b)   any minutes of a resolution passed by members without a meeting.

Note:   The member may ask the corporation for an English translation under subsection   376 - 5(3) if the minutes are not in the English language.

  (5)   If the corporation does not require the member to pay for the copy, the corporation must send it:

  (a)   within 14 days after the member asks for it; or

  (b)   within any longer period that the Registrar approves.

Penalty:   5 penalty units.

  (6)   If the corporation requires payment for the copy, the corporation must send it:

  (a)   within 14 days after the corporation receives the payment; or

  (b)   within any longer period that the Registrar approves.

The amount of any payment the corporation requires cannot exceed the prescribed amount.

Penalty:   5 penalty units.

  (7)   An offence against subsection   (3), (5) or (6) is an offence of strict liability.

Note:   For strict liability , see section   6.1 of the Criminal Code .
